Riskeer

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Implemented creating input for macro stability outwards. WTI-1683

Implemented creating input for macro stability inwards. WTI-1683

Implemented creating input for grass inwards. WTI-1683

Implemented creating input for piping. WTI-1683

m => km. WTI-1683

Reverted commit 2fe551e21919f12345f07299fb292669fe43207f, reapplied 2fe551e21919f12345f07299fb292669fe43207f:

Cleanup:

- Removed the .Any()-check in the data synchronization service --> .AddRange() can add empty collections.

WTI-1574

Reverted commit 354a2f287b65fa018a178f5ab6a883f4a922fe65, reapplied commit edb30387c62455caa5ca32f9f53f59f1c1a8c3f0:

Cleanup:

- Grouped calculation retrieval of the dune locations in a separate function

- Renamed functions

WTI-1574

Reverted commit 6bef052bbf6326ca12a38909200a11a69c34cebd, reapplied commit d1fa1a3e7da0efbdaca3e2fd30a4deb20d7662e3: Adjusted tests for the change handler for assessment section to clear output after changing the composition: - Every exposed calculation list on the failure mechanism is cleared in addition to the dune locations

WTI-1574

Reverted commit 1bd68d22bc0484d9d18afb2a776b8f5943712803, reapplied commit 15d708dd6d9cceee5573169f2bdf96f497a31247:

Adjusted RingtoetsDataSynchronisation service to clear output after changing the norm:

- Every exposed calculation list on the failure mechanism is cleared in addition to the dune locations

- Adjusted tests such that they verify the affected objects also contain the affected calculations from the exposed lists

Note: fixed merge conflicts here, adapted tests files such that they are corresponding with the current test setup.

WTI-1574

Add calculatable failure mechanism observer WTI-1687

Improve assembly result test fixture WTI-1687

Expanded test data generator. WTI-1683

Change interface of calculation objects to use typed variant WTI-1687

Reverted commit df65ea020222eb9b46294af5084e02bb83b684a4, reapplied commit 6c0c2450b93849e5fd6caa0182cb590d21e58547: Adjusted change handler for the failure mechanism to clear output after changing N: - Every exposed calculation list on the failure mechanism is cleared in addition to the dune locations

WTI-1574

Reverted commit 35cdb63312e00d641feb421d02e99b08b087938f, reapplied commit 76ae563a2db79178d0a21533f320f17d738f4048: Refactored datasynchronisation services for dune erosion: - Grouped removal of outputs under one generic function which removes the all the output from the collections within a dune erosion failure mechanism

WTI-1574

Reverted commit aa09279c23d20a532712b4e0a8abe942a879149f, reapplied commit 14ec2ab7889eccf1d88fd68036b96bfcade83eff: Adjusted TestDataGenerator to generate DuneLocation calculations for every norm: - Done as a preparation for the change handler tests on assessment section

WTI-1574

Reverted commit d18c49efb0d6e0b49fb9a54daf3589d6069a62b1, reapplied commit fdd2ef5df1a8c575ff40ac874c25c81afbabd176

Implemented DataSynchronization-service to remove the output of dune location calculations:

- Made calculations observable as preparation --> objects should listen to the dune calculations instead of the location after the feature change

WTI-1574

Reverted commit c36d1359e5853619d9fcb8a57d3b5ee2e3d9f1d9, reapplied 50d24a0bfc47a558a84c013611540c9f0f846caf: - Set DuneLocationCalculations when importing a hydraulic boundary location database

WTI-1574

Reverted commit a73bfe0609da8d0c2c2c9f4d6ad3e0f044ea89b3, reapplied d5286bfba1709a9e46355d6f1fff0989d78b7f9a: Revert "Notify the DuneLocationCalculationCollection observers when importing a hydraulic boundary location database""

WTI-1574

Cleanup TestDataGeneratorTest. WTI-1683

Reverted commit 46ab9597ce97c9fb74ab0b46ade99b438a60f785, reapplied commit 1c6f3ac4b5c73708b74e7d6491b6988c3ff4aa1a:

Exposed 5 calculation lists for the dune locations on failure mechanism level:

- Similar as GrassCoverErosionOutwards failure mechanism

WTI-1574

Reverted commit 59527a5120b5c6c1239449c823ea6b0f76000df6, reapplied commit 6b62fabacd0f7c8409d46d69f5adac5dd5f18d1c:

Added reference to the dune location in the calculation class:

- Fixed compiling errors

WTI-1574

Introduced factory for creating the input. WTI-1683

Added rounding for the view: - Indications for the start and end point of each section are annotated with a '*'. Values are rounded on 3 decimals.

WTI-1684

Introduced error provider: - Added logic to set and clear the provider in the view already.

WTI-1684

Moved converting function from the FailureMechanismSectionResultRowHelper to a separate class - Usage is not only limited to FailureMechanismSectionResultRows anymore.

WTI-1684

  1. … 29 more files in changeset.
Removed enum type converters: - Values of type FailureMechanismSectionAssemblyCategoryGroup should be converted to their display variant before being displayed.

WTI-1684

Incorporated cell formatting logic in the view: - Added tests

WTI-1684

Use correct variable in tests WTI-1594

Introduced column state definitions for the row object: - Added logic to set color based on the results

WTI-1684